Understanding Today's Crossword Puzzle
The clue "Molasses" has the answer "TREACLE" for today's crossword puzzle.
Here's why this answer fits the clue:
- Sweetness: Treacle is a viscous syrup made from refining sugar, known for its rich, sweet taste, similar to molasses.
- British Term: In British English, "treacle" is commonly used to refer to molasses, making it a fitting answer for the clue.
- Context: Both molasses and treacle are sticky, dark syrups used in baking and cooking, enhancing the depth of flavor in various dishes.
- Culinary Connection: Treacle and molasses share a culinary connection in terms of their flavor profiles and uses in traditional recipes, such as treacle tart.

Definition of "TREACLE"
a thick, sticky dark syrup made from partly refined sugar; molasses.
